From e94ed347105dff7619d52e24bb8c298c6d5d06fd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: youling257 Date: Tue, 4 Apr 2017 19:32:19 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] ASoC: Intel: bytcr_rt5640: quirks for Insyde devices [ Upstream commit 571800487837263e914ef68681e4ad6a57d49c7f ] There are literally dozens of Insyde devices with a different name but with the same audio routing. Use a generic quirk to match on vendor name only to avoid recurring edits of the same thing.
